how to fix cross site scripting vulnerability in javascript
The idea behind an XSS attack with innerHTML is that malicious code would get injected into your site and then execute. 4 Blind Cross-Site Scripting. ERP Sankhya versions 4.13.x and below suffer from a cross site scripting vulnerability. Blind cross-site scripting attacks occur when an attacker cant see the result of an attack. XSS vulnerabilities can be mitigated in a couple of different ways. Critical Vulnerability can be used to run attacker code and install software, requiring no user interaction beyond normal browsing. geeeeen Asks: When i open up a new application its already connected to a firebase account which is i don't have access to When i open up a new application its already connected to a firebase account which is i don't have access to, is it possible to connect it to new project using new account and not with the one which i lost access to. Reflected XSS. Cross-site scripting (XSS) vulnerabilities occur when: Data enters a web application through an untrusted source. The site security scanner also attempts to detect sensitive files from the server (e.g. Upgrade to Nagios XI 5.5.7 or above. Password requirements: 6 to 30 characters long; ASCII characters only (characters found on a standard US keyboard); must contain at least 4 different symbols; Content Writer $ 247 Our private A.I. Cross-site Scripting can also be used in conjunction with other types of attacks, for example, Cross-Site Request Forgery (CSRF). These scripts get executed when a user loads the infected page. In my application(asp.net) we are dynamically constructing html and assign it to a div tag where it is complaining as issue. An effective approach to preventing cross site scripting attacks, which may require a lot of adjustments to your web applications design and code base, is to use a content security policy. One is to ensure that user input doesnt contain anything malicious or potentially damaging. A denial-of-service vulnerability exists when creating HTTPS web request during X509 certificate chain building. Both XSS and SQL injection attacks result from weakness in your code that fails to distinguish between data and commands. Help & FAQ for all Opera browsers is here, at the official Opera Software site. There are many ways in which a malicious website can transmit such commands; specially For example, it prevents a malicious website on the Internet from running JS in a browser to read data from a third-party webmail Cross-site scripting (XSS) is a code injection attack on web applications. Set a Content Security Policy as an HTTP Header The most common way of setting a Content Security Policy is by setting it directly in the HTTP Header. Affected versions of this package are vulnerable to Cross-site Scripting (XSS) via the SSI printenv command. The complexity of todays websites and web-applications practically mandates the use of security testing tools. How to Prevent Cross Site Scripting Attacks in JavaScript. Performing input validation to remove tag at the end. In these attacks, the vulnerability commonly lies on a page where only authorized users can access. About. Cross-Site Scripting (XSS) attacks are a type of injection, in which malicious scripts are injected into otherwise benign and trusted web sites. The user then unknowingly becomes the victim of the attack. There are several types of Cross-site Scripting attacks: stored/persistent XSS, reflected/non-persistent XSS, and DOM-based XSS. Cross-Site-Scripting allows an attacker to execute JavaScript in the attacked origin, allowing the attacker to act like the exploited user of the website. 74cmsSE v3.12.0 was discovered to contain a cross-site scripting (XSS) vulnerability via the component /apiadmin/notice/add. A persistent cross-site scripting (XSS) vulnerability exists in the Nagios XI Business Process Intelligence (BPI) components api_tool.php. XSS, or Cross-site scripting, is a type of attack on a web application that allows an attacker to compromise the visitors of the infected web application. As with some other per-site switches, the default state of the per-site JavaScript master switch can be set in the Settings pane, thus allowing to disable JavaScript everywhere by default, and enable on a per-site basis: JavaScript master switch rules appear as no-scripting: [hostname] true entries in the My rules pane. MFSA 2006-19 Cross-site scripting using .valueOf.call() MFSA 2006-18 Mozilla Firefox Tag Order Vulnerability; MFSA 2006-17 cross-site scripting through window.controllers; MFSA 2006-16 Accessing XBL compilation scope via valueOf.call() MFSA 2006-15 Privilege escalation using a JavaScript function's cloned parent This makes your application relatively database independent. A remote code execution vulnerability exists when Visual Studio loads a malicious repository containing JavaScript or TypeScript code files. org.apache.tomcat:tomcat-catalina is a Tomcat Servlet Engine Core Classes and Standard implementations. This particular variant was submitted by ukasz Pilorz and was based partially off of Ozh's protocol resolution bypass below. What it basically does is remove all suspicious strings from request parameters before returning them to the application. PHP originally stood for Personal Home Page, but it now stands for the recursive initialism PHP: Hypertext Preprocessor.. PHP code is usually By exploiting XSS vulnerability, an attacker can inject malicious scripts on a page of the infected web application. 'www.example.com'), in which case they will be matched Trusted Types give you the tools to write, security review, and maintain applications free of DOM XSS vulnerabilities by making the dangerous web API functions secure by default. tags | exploit, xss Download | Favorite | View Red Hat Security Advisory 2022-7209-01 Posted Oct 26, 2022 Authored by Red Hat | Site access.redhat.com You can read more about them in an article titled Types of XSS. Furthermore, there is a differentiation between the vulnerability caused by a flawed input validation on the client- or server-side. DOM-based cross-site scripting (DOM XSS) is one of the most common web security vulnerabilities, and it's very easy to introduce it in your application. Cross site scripting (XSS) protection XSS attacks allow a user to inject client side scripts into the browsers of other users. This vulnerability allows attackers to execute arbitrary web scripts or HTML via a crafted payload injected into the Title field. Therefore, if the attacker injects JavaScript into eval(), your app would run the attackers script. Note: Server Side Includes (SSI) is disabled by default and is intended for debugging purposes only. Over 500,000 Words Free; The same A.I. Code The risk of a Cross-Site Scripting vulnerability can range from cookie stealing, temporary website defacement, injecting malicious scripts, or reading Developers tend to like the Prepared Statement approach because all the SQL code stays within the application. st lucie county property appraiser a b A Cross-Site Scripting vulnerability occurs when a web application allows users to add custom code in the URL path.